Two supervised chemometric algorithms (discriminant analysis and artificial neutral networks) were used to elaborate the protein transfer reaction-mass spectrometry (PTR-MS) data of 63 strawberry samples from 2 cultivars harvested in 2002 from Italy. This technique allowed the discrimination of the cultivars using only 2 variables. Measurements were non-destructive on single fruits.
